Output 31590e0444b1be0cbb9ce6491195aa460133f8cba21edaeec1cb075020489662:0

value
11546000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e366c603a693bccc935e4e806c0ac98d22d31ec9 OP_EQUALVERIFY OP_CHECKSIG
address
1MjPWNdmq1hANaomqTE17Buub76ZrPgqTr
transaction
31590e0444b1be0cbb9ce6491195aa460133f8cba21edaeec1cb075020489662
spent
true